Do hurricanes hit Mobile Alabama?

August 28–30, 2005: Hurricane Katrina caused 2 deaths and tropical storm-force winds in Alabama. Mobile Bay spilled into Mobile. Katrina brought 6.59 inches of rainfall to Alabama. For other effects, see the article Effects of Hurricane Katrina in Alabama.

What is minimum wage in Mobile Alabama?

$7.25 per hour
Alabama’s state minimum wage rate is $7.25 per hour. This is the same as the current Federal Minimum Wage rate. The minimum wage applies to most employees in Alabama, with limited exceptions including tipped employees, some student workers, and other exempt occupations.

What is a good salary in Mobile Alabama?

A good salary in Mobile, AL is anything over $41,000. That’s because the median income in Mobile is $41,000, which means if you earn more than that you’re earning more than 50% of the people living in Mobile. The average salary in Mobile is $48,330.

When was the last hurricane in Alabama?

On September 16, 2020, Hurricane Sally moved onshore in Gulf Shores at 5:45 a.m. as a Category 2 hurricane. This slow-moving storm with peak sustained winds at 110 miles per hour caused extensive flooding, leaving hundreds of thousands of people without electricity.
